Are Muslims allowed to pray more than 5 times a day

In Arabic, Salat, or Salah, means connection, contact, and communication. The Salat, the obligatory Muslim prayers, is the second of the Five Pillars of Islam. There is some discussion about the number of times the prayers must be said, although five times a day is the most common.

Is praying 5 times a day one of the 5 pillars of Islam

Prayer (salat).

Muslims pray facing Mecca five times a day: at dawn, noon, mid-afternoon, sunset, and after dark. Prayer includes a recitation of the opening chapter (sura) of the Qur'an, and is sometimes performed on a small rug or mat used expressly for this purpose (see image 24).

What percentage of Muslims pray all 5 prayers

In Central Asia, Tajik Muslims are the most devout in this regard, with 39% performing the five required prayers each day. Elsewhere in the region, fewer than three-in-ten perform all five salat, including just 2% of Muslims in Kazakhstan. Daily prayer is also less common in Southern and Eastern Europe.

Why do Shia pray 3 times a day

Shi'a Muslims have more freedom to combine certain prayers, such as the midday and afternoon prayers. Therefore they may only pray three times a day. Shi'a Muslims also often use natural elements when praying. For example, some place a piece of clay at the spot where their head will rest.

Did the Prophet pray 50 times a day

The prophet went back and the number was lowered to 45. Moses again told him to return and request that the number be decreased. The number was again lowered, but not by much, to 40. Moses continued to send him back until the daily prayer was lowered from 50 to five.
